Academic Mission
The Bachelor of Education Science Secondary program at Kampala International University is designed to equip students with comprehensive pedagogical knowledge and specialized subject matter expertise for teaching science at the secondary level. This undergraduate program emphasizes a strong foundation in scientific disciplines such as biology, chemistry, physics, and mathematics, integrated with modern educational theories and practical teaching methodologies. Students will develop critical thinking, problem-solving, and instructional design skills essential for effective science education. The curriculum includes extensive practicum experiences in diverse secondary school settings, allowing for the application of learned principles and the development of professional teaching competencies. Graduates are prepared for careers as qualified science teachers in secondary schools, curriculum developers, or educational researchers.
